We already have real traffic, real backlinks, public talent profiles, active job listings, blog content, and programmatic SEO landing pages. This isn't a "help us get started" project. We need someone who can look at what's already live, figure out why commercially valuable pages aren't performing the way they should, and fix it.
We're not looking for an entry-level SEO person, a content writer, or someone who will run an Ahrefs or Semrush audit and hand us a PDF of things we already know. We want a senior, hands-on operator who can pull apart our Search Console data and site structure, form a real hypothesis about what's holding a page back, implement or direct the fix, measure the result, and keep iterating.
What you'll actually be doing:
- Diagnosing why specific commercially valuable pages are underperforming, using GSC data and site structure analysis
- Technical SEO: indexing issues, crawl budget, architecture, and the page-speed factors that actually move rankings
- Programmatic SEO: template design and page-level differentiation, avoiding thin or duplicate content at scale
- Fixing keyword cannibalization and clarifying page targeting and search intent across overlapping pages
- Internal linking strategy, not just adding more links but linking that actually shifts rankings
- Competitor analysis that leads to specific actions, not a list of what competitors happen to be doing
- On-page optimization tied to a hypothesis, not a generic checklist
- Identifying real content gaps tied to commercial intent
- Legitimate backlink or link acquisition work where it's actually needed to move a specific page
- Giving our developer precise, correct implementation instructions and verifying the work once it's live
We already have a developer. You don't need to write code, but you need to understand technical SEO well enough to spec exact changes and confirm the implementation actually matches what you asked for.
